The Railways Department announces that the next attractive week-end excursion \to Auckland and Frankton Junction has been arranged for the week-end August 5 to August 8. The excursion train will leave Wellington on Friday night (August 5), and will arrive at Auckland on Saturday morning. The return train will leave Auckland at 3.5 p.m. on Sunday (August 7) and will arrive in Wellington at 6.33 a.m. on Monday. The fares are at a cheap rate, with free reservation of seats. The excursion covers all sta-

tions in Manawatu, Wairarapa and Hawke’s Bay districts. See advertisement in this issue.
